    AnnotationYttrium garnet, Y3Fe5O12, films of excellent purity were grown by liquid phase epitaxy from a lead-free BaO-B2O3-BaF2 flux. The films were characterized by the nuclear magnetic resonance, ferroemagnetic resonance, and paralell pumping method.
